Waikiki Beach Summer Monday Makers Market 2026 in Waikiki, HI: Dates, Handmade Goods, Live Entertainment, and What to Expect

The 2026 Waikiki Beach Summer Monday Makers Market is set to bring an evening of artisan shopping, local food, live entertainment, and community fun to Waikiki, Hawaii this June. This summer makers market will feature handcrafted goods, jewelry, desserts, giveaways, and more in the heart of Waikiki.

Event Dates

The Waikiki Beach Summer Monday Makers Market will take place on June 1, 2026.

Event Location

The market will be hosted at Waikiki Beach Walk, located at:
226 Lewers Street, Waikiki, HI 96815

The open-air venue provides a lively tropical setting for shopping, dining, and evening entertainment.

Event Highlights

Visitors can enjoy a wide variety of attractions and local vendors, including:

  • Handcrafted artisan items
  • Permanent jewelry vendors
  • Prepackaged foods and desserts
  • Freshly cooked food vendors
  • Live entertainment and performances
  • Giveaways throughout the day
  • Opportunities to support local makers and small businesses

This event is ideal for shoppers, tourists, families, and anyone looking to enjoy a fun summer evening in Waikiki.

Event Hours

  • Monday: 4:00 PM – 8:00 PM

Entry and Tickets

Free admission — visitors can attend at no cost.
